View moreThe United States Geological Survey (USGS) Eastern Ecological Science Center (EESC) has a requirement for liquid propane gas delivery at the Leetown Science Center (LSC) in Kearneysville, West Virginia. This procurement involves weekly automatic fill-ups for government-owned tanks to support ongoing operations. The agency intends to award a single-award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ract with a not-to-exceed ceiling of $450,000. Task orders will be issued on a firm-fixed-price basis over a performance period not to exceed three years.
Solicitation 140G0123Q0121 is a 100% Total Small Business set-aside. The requirement is classified under NAICS 324110 Petroleum Refineries and PSC 6830 GASES: COMPRESSED AND LIQUEFIED. All responsible sources are invited to submit written quotes by the response deadline of April 24, 2023. Submissions and inquiries are directed to Kimberly Schneider at the USGS.
The solicitation package includes two attachments: a pricing document and the primary solicitation file. Administrative updates were documented through three amendments published between April 6 and April 19, 2023. Award eligibility requires active registration in the System for Award Management (SAM).
